Experts from Goldman Sachs, one of the world's leading investment banks, predict that Wall Street will experience increased activity in mergers and acquisitions over the long term. This is despite the current volatility affecting market deals. A senior dealmaker at the bank confirmed that there are "large amounts of capital" available, enhancing the opportunities for executing new transactions.

These statements come at a time when the market is experiencing significant fluctuations, with rising concerns about economic recession and increasing interest rates. Nevertheless, experts believe that the availability of substantial liquidity will help companies capitalize on available market opportunities.

Background & Context

Historically, Wall Street has witnessed periods of intense activity in mergers and acquisitions, especially during times of economic recovery. However, economic crises, such as the global financial crisis of 2008, led to a significant decline in these activities. But as the economy recovers, companies have once again begun to seek growth opportunities through mergers.

In recent years, there has been a notable increase in the number of large deals across various sectors, including technology and healthcare. With ongoing technological innovations and market changes, these trends are expected to continue into the future.
